The evolution of visual technology in gaming has transformed how players experience their favorite classics. From simple pixelated sprites to immersive 3D worlds, advancements in graphics have redefined storytelling and gameplay. Understanding this progression reveals how modern tools like WebGL are bridging nostalgic aesthetics with cutting-edge visuals, making timeless games accessible and engaging for new generations.
Table of Contents
2. Understanding WebGL: The Technology Behind Modern Web Graphics
3. Bridging the Gap: From Static Retro Graphics to Dynamic 3D
4. Case Study: Bringing ‘Chicken Road 2’ to Life with WebGL
5. Educational Insights: The Intersection of Technology, Nostalgia, and Gaming
6. Broader Impacts: WebGL’s Role in the Gaming Ecosystem and Culture
7. Non-Obvious Depth: Technical and Artistic Challenges in WebGL Game Revival
8. Conclusion: The Future of Classic Games in the WebGL Era
The Evolution of Visuals in Classic Gaming
a. Historical Context of Early Game Graphics and Limitations
In the early days of video gaming, hardware constraints imposed significant limitations on visual fidelity. Systems like the Atari 2600 and Nintendo Entertainment System (NES) relied heavily on 8-bit graphics, with pixel art and sprite-based visuals that, while charming, lacked depth and realism. Developers focused on optimizing limited memory and processing power to deliver engaging gameplay, often sacrificing visual complexity for fluid performance.
b. Transition from 2D Sprites to 3D Environments
The late 20th century saw a shift toward 3D graphics, driven by advancements in hardware like the Sony PlayStation and Nintendo 64. This transition introduced polygonal models and textured environments, creating more immersive worlds. Classic games such as Super Mario 64 exemplified how 3D environments enhanced gameplay, allowing for new mechanics like camera control and spatial navigation, enriching player experience.
c. Importance of Visual Realism in Modern Gaming Experiences
Today, high-fidelity graphics are central to delivering realistic and emotionally engaging stories. Titles like The Last of Us Part II or Cyberpunk 2077 showcase how detailed textures, dynamic lighting, and complex shaders create believable worlds. This push for realism enhances immersion, making games not just entertainment but profound artistic expressions. However, recreating this level of visual quality in browser-based games remains a technical challenge and opportunity.
Understanding WebGL: The Technology Behind Modern Web Graphics
a. What is WebGL and How Does It Work?
WebGL (Web Graphics Library) is a JavaScript API that enables rendering interactive 2D and 3D graphics within web browsers without the need for plugins. It leverages the GPU (Graphics Processing Unit) to perform complex calculations, allowing for real-time rendering of detailed visuals. WebGL’s API closely mirrors OpenGL ES, a subset of the OpenGL standard used in many graphics applications and games.
b. Comparison Between WebGL and Traditional Graphics APIs (OpenGL, DirectX)
| Aspect | WebGL | OpenGL / DirectX |
|---|---|---|
| Platform Compatibility | Browser-based, cross-platform | Desktop and console applications |
| Ease of Use | JavaScript API, easier for web developers | More complex, requires C/C++ knowledge |
| Performance | High, but browser limitations exist | Optimized for native hardware |
| Use Cases | Web-based games, visualizations | AAA games, professional graphics applications |
c. Advantages of WebGL for Browser-Based Gaming
WebGL democratizes access to high-quality graphics by allowing complex, interactive visuals directly within web browsers. This eliminates the need for users to install dedicated software or plugins, enabling instant play on any device with a compatible browser. Additionally, WebGL supports hardware acceleration, ensuring that even resource-intensive visuals can run smoothly, making browser games more competitive and engaging.
Bridging the Gap: From Static Retro Graphics to Dynamic 3D
a. Challenges of Recreating Classic Games with Modern Technology
Reimagining vintage titles with contemporary tools involves overcoming several hurdles. Preserving the nostalgic pixel art and sprite-based charm while leveraging 3D rendering demands careful artistic and technical balancing. Hardware limitations, such as browser performance constraints and memory management, further complicate this process. Developers must optimize assets and code to ensure smooth gameplay without sacrificing visual quality.
b. Techniques Used in WebGL to Preserve Nostalgic Aesthetics While Enhancing Visuals
Techniques such as shader programming, texture mapping, and dynamic lighting allow developers to evoke retro aesthetics within a modern 3D framework. For example, pixel shaders can simulate the pixelated look of 8-bit graphics, while textured models replicate familiar sprites. Combining these with advanced lighting effects breathes new life into classic visuals while maintaining their nostalgic essence.
c. Role of Shaders, Textures, and Lighting in Revitalizing Old Games
Shaders are programmable scripts that manipulate how surfaces appear under various lighting conditions, crucial for creating atmospheric effects. Textures wrap around 3D models, adding detail and authenticity. Proper lighting enhances depth and mood, transforming flat sprites into engaging, visually dynamic scenes. These tools enable reimaginings like InOut studio title to retain nostalgic charm while offering immersive 3D experiences.
Case Study: Bringing ‘Chicken Road 2’ to Life with WebGL
a. How WebGL Enables Interactive and Immersive Gameplay Experiences
WebGL’s ability to render complex 3D environments directly in browsers transforms static retro titles into interactive worlds. Players can now navigate, rotate, and explore game scenes in real-time, enhancing engagement. For instance, ‘Chicken Road 2’ leverages WebGL to animate characters, animate backgrounds, and create dynamic interactions that were impossible in traditional 2D versions.
b. Examples of Visual Enhancements in ‘Chicken Road 2’ through WebGL
The game showcases improvements such as realistic lighting effects on characters, textured environments that add depth, and smooth animations that bring the game’s lively aesthetic to life. WebGL allows developers to implement shaders that mimic vintage pixel art while adding modern visual effects, creating a seamless blend of nostalgia and innovation.
c. The Impact of 3D Rendering on Gameplay Mechanics and Player Engagement
Transitioning to 3D enhances gameplay by enabling new mechanics such as multi-angle views, collision detection, and environmental interactions. This depth fosters greater player immersion and strategic depth. As players explore in a 3D space, their connection to the game world deepens, demonstrating how technological advances can revitalize classic titles for modern audiences.
Educational Insights: The Intersection of Technology, Nostalgia, and Gaming
a. How WebGL Democratizes Access to High-Quality Game Graphics
WebGL enables developers to create high-end graphics that are accessible to anyone with a modern browser, regardless of device or operating system. This democratization means that retro games can be reimagined and enjoyed without specialized hardware or software, broadening their cultural reach.
b. The Influence of Visual Realism on Game Design and Storytelling
Enhanced visuals allow game designers to craft richer narratives and more immersive worlds. Realistic lighting and textures evoke emotional responses, deepen engagement, and enable storytelling techniques like environmental storytelling or character expression. The trend toward realism influences how games like modernized classics tell their stories, blending tradition with innovation.
c. The Importance of Preserving Classics While Innovating with New Tech
Retaining the essence of original games ensures cultural preservation, while technological innovation breathes new life into these titles. WebGL-based remakes exemplify this balance, allowing players to experience familiar gameplay in a fresh, visually compelling context. This approach safeguards gaming heritage while embracing progress.
Broader Impacts: WebGL’s Role in the Gaming Ecosystem and Culture
a. Expansion of Browser Games and Their Economic Significance ($7.8 billion annually)
Browser-based gaming has become a significant segment of the global gaming industry, generating billions annually. WebGL’s capabilities facilitate the development of high-quality web games, expanding market access and reducing development costs. This growth fosters innovation and diversity in game offerings, making classics more accessible and profitable.
b. Cultural Reflections: From Las Vegas’s “Sin City” Nickname to Vintage Glamour
The cultural symbolism of vintage objects, like the turquoise 1957 Chevrolet Bel Air, echoes the nostalgic appeal of classic games. WebGL-enabled remakes serve as digital tributes, blending historical aesthetics with modern technology, thus reinforcing cultural connections across generations and media.
c. WebGL’s Contribution to Gaming Accessibility and Community Building
By lowering barriers to high-quality gaming experiences, WebGL fosters inclusive communities. Players worldwide can share and enjoy remastered classics effortlessly, promoting cultural exchange and collaborative innovation in game design.